Documentary / Historical
Luxury liner
Chris Alstrin (2008)
In 1976, Indian Creek was a little-known, dried-up, ancient riverbed in southeastern Utah. But in that year the impossible became the possible: Earl Wiggins climbed 'Supercrack', a 300-foot vertical sandstone fracture, from the ground up. Indian Creek is now considered one of the finest international climbing destinations in the world. 'Luxury Liner' is the story of a bold man behind an unthinkable idea. It pairs historical footage of the first ascent of 'Supercrack' with recent interviews that reminisce on an earlier time, when climbing necessitated fearlessness, confidence, finesse and humility.- 2008
